모든 블로그
네이버 페이

네이버 페이

도메인medium.com
주요 카테고리 Backend

활동 요약

대표 인기 포스트신입개발자의 역량과 성장에 대해서(feat. Done is better than perfect)360 조회
최근 30일
0개
평균 조회
127
누적 조회
2,407
전체 글
19개
마지막 발행
2026. 5. 11.
블로그 방문

최신 게시글 (19)

2026년 5월 11일

백엔드

Composite PK에서 시작된 Spring Boot 4 / Spring Batch 6 업그레이드 기록

Spring Data JDBC의 Composite ID 적용을 계기로 Spring Boot 4와 Spring Batch 6 업그레이드를 진행했습니다. 복합키 매핑, 배치 메타데이터 변경, Kotlin·Jackson·Gradle 호환성까지 함께 정리했습니다.

#Spring Boot#Spring Batch#Spring Data JDBC
14000

2025년 8월 7일

백엔드

신입개발자의 역량과 성장에 대해서(feat. Done is better than perfect)

신입 개발자에게 필요한 소통, 탐색, 기록, 질문의 태도를 중심으로 성장 방법을 정리했습니다. 완벽한 코드보다 동작하는 기능부터 시작해 점진적으로 개선하자는 메시지를 담았습니다.

#Java#Kotlin#Spring Boot
36000

2025년 8월 5일

백엔드

똑같은 코드인데 왜 안 돼? Spring JDBC 컨버터 미궁 탈출기

Spring Data JDBC에서 LocalDate 컨버터가 기대와 다르게 동작하는 이유를 JDBC 내부 처리 순서와 Oracle 드라이버 차이로 분석했습니다. 이를 피하기 위해 커스텀 래퍼 타입과 양방향 컨버터로 저장 형식을 제어하는 방법을 정리했습니다.

#Spring JDBC#Spring Data JDBC#JDBC
16600

2025년 7월 31일

백엔드

MongoDB CQRS 성능 개선기: 예상치 못한 Tomcat NDJSON 병목 해결

CQRS와 MongoDB 도입 후에도 엑셀 다운로드가 느린 원인을 Tomcat의 NDJSON flush 병목에서 찾았습니다. 1000개씩 버퍼링해 직접 write하도록 바꿔 성능 개선을 이끌었습니다.

#MongoDB#CQRS#Tomcat
10400

2025년 6월 30일

백엔드

레거시 시스템 교체기: 실시간 트래픽 미러링을 통한 안정적 전환 사례

레거시 WebFlux 신용점수 조회 서비스를 WebMVC로 전환하며, Nginx 트래픽 미러링으로 실서비스 검증을 수행했습니다. 응답 자동 비교와 짧은 타임아웃으로 사용자 영향 없이 안정적으로 마이그레이션했습니다.

#Spring WebFlux#Spring WebMVC#Kotlin
23500

2025년 6월 24일

백엔드

도메인 Error를 다루는 고민과 Arrow의 Either

결제 도메인의 오류 처리를 위해 sealed class를 검토한 뒤 Arrow의 Either를 도입한 과정을 정리했습니다. 트랜잭션, 캐시, 예외 처리와의 충돌을 피하기 위해 계층별 경계도 함께 설계했습니다.

#Kotlin#Spring Boot#Arrow
12300

2025년 6월 17일

백엔드

Node.js가 싱글스레드 서버라는 미신(feat. Node.js의 대용량 데이터 처리)

Node.js는 싱글스레드처럼 보이지만 내부적으로는 멀티스레드 요소를 활용하는 구조를 설명했습니다. 대용량 데이터 처리에서는 CPU 병목을 스케일아웃과 운영 설계로 풀어낸 사례를 다뤘습니다.

#node.js#싱글스레드#event loop
35100

2025년 6월 2일

백엔드

Opensearch 검색엔진을 이용한 네이버 페이 검색 하기

네이버페이 검색 서비스를 OpenSearch로 구축하며 색인 구조와 한글 검색 품질 개선 과정을 소개했습니다. 또한 무중단 패치, 최근 검색어 저장, 특수문자 예외 처리까지 운영 경험을 정리했습니다.

#OpenSearch#검색#MongoDB
24400

2025년 5월 23일

백엔드

실무에서 만나는 DB isolation level

MySQL 기본 격리 수준인 REPEATABLE READ 때문에 결제 트랜잭션에서 오래된 잔액이 유지되는 문제를 겪었습니다. 락 위치와 격리 수준을 조정해 동시성 이슈를 해결하는 과정을 정리했습니다.

#DB#transaction#MySQL
23800

2024년 10월 11일

기타

FAST: 데이터 파이프라인 이제는 웹에서

목차 0. 들어가며 0.1 데이터 활용을 위해 필수불가결한 배치 시스템 1. 기존 데이터 활용 배치 시스템의 문제점 1.1 Zeppelin Cron 기능을 이용한

2900

2024년 10월 2일

기타

Uplift Modeling을 통한 마케팅 비용 최적화 (with Multiple Treatments)

안녕하세요, 네이버페이 인텔리전스서비스 박대한입니다. 마케팅 비용 최적화 문제를 uplift modeling으로 정의하고, 인과추론(causal inference) 모델을

3400

2024년 9월 30일

기타

상태 관리 라이브러리 vanilla-store

상태 관리 라이브러리 vanilla-store를 소개합니다! 안녕하세요. 내자산&회원FE팀 김현석입니다. 리액트를 사용하는 개발자들에게 상태 관리는 항상 중요한 고민거리입

3800

2024년 6월 18일

기타

Spring Security 의 인증 알아보기

안녕하세요. 네이버페이 회원&인증BE 의최용화입니다. Spring Security는 강력한 보안 프레임워크로서, 애플리케이션의 인증과 인가 과정을 효율적으로 관리합니다.

4800

2024년 6월 10일

기타

nGrinder를 활용한 부하테스트

안녕하세요. 금융 FE 임문수입니다. 네이버페이 부동산에서 부하테스트를 진행한 경험을 바탕으로 부하테스트에 대한 설명과 nGinder를 활용한 부하테스트를 진행했던 과정에

3300

2024년 3월 27일

기타

GitHub Actions 활용하기

안녕하세요, 네이버 페이에서 프론트엔드를 개발하고 있는이창재입니다. 네이버 파이낸셜에서는 GitHub를 통해 코드를 관리하고 있고, 자연스레 GitHub Actions를

4600

2024년 3월 7일

기타

코드, 어떻게 관리하세요?

안녕하세요, 네이버페이 내자산&회원FE에서 프론트엔드 개발하는이선아입니다. 저희 팀이 담당하는 일은 원용님의 아래 글에 잘 정리되어있습니다. 내자산: 마이데이터 자산 조회

6100

2024년 1월 25일

기타

내자산: 마이데이터 자산 조회

(feat. WebSocket) 안녕하세요. 네이버페이 내자산&회원FE 팀의김원용입니다. 저희 팀은 네이버페이 포인트는 물론, 마이데이터를 통한 다양한 금융 기관의 자산

3800

2023년 11월 23일

기타

공개키 암호화와 키관리 (MPC)

안녕하세요, 네이버페이 금융인프라개발 임지선입니다. 공개키 암호화의 개념과 거기에서 사용되는 개인키를 안전하게 보관하기 위한 키 암호화 방식에 대해 소개ᄒ

1900

2023년 9월 12일

기타

deFign : 네이버 페이의 디자인 시스템을 정의하다

deFign: 네이버페이의 디자인 시스템을정의하다 안녕하세요. 네이버페이 금융FE, 디자인시스템TF 소속안재연입니다. 출처: https://m.post.naver.com/

10000